Material Considerations for Metal Roofing Gutters
Selecting the right material for metal roofing gutters is crucial, as it directly influences the system’s durability and efficiency. Homeowners often seek to integrate materials that seamlessly complement their metal roofs, enhancing both aesthetic appeal and functionality.
Aluminum is a popular choice due to its lightweight nature and corrosion resistance, which aligns well with metal roofs. Alternatively, galvanized steel offers robust durability and can withstand harsh weather conditions, providing a sense of security for the community during storms.
Copper gutters, while more expensive, offer unparalleled longevity and a distinct appearance that ages gracefully, appealing to those who value timeless elegance.
Additionally, vinyl gutters, though less common for metal roofs, present a cost-effective option for those prioritizing budget. Frequently Asked Questions About Gutters for Metal Roofs
-
Why are gutters necessary for metal roofs?
Gutters are essential for metal roofs because they channel rainwater and snowmelt away from the foundation, preventing erosion, basement flooding, and structural damage. Metal roofs shed water quickly, so a properly installed gutter system is crucial to manage the runoff and protect both the roof and the property.
-
Are gutter guards effective for metal roof systems?
Yes. Gutter guards are highly effective for metal roofs. Since metal roofs shed debris more efficiently, adding gutter guards helps prevent leaves, twigs, and other materials from clogging the system. This reduces maintenance and ensures consistent water flow, especially during storms.
-
Do metal roofs require special gutter installation techniques?
They do. Metal roofs often require special brackets and installation methods to prevent damage from snow slides and expansion. Roofers must use compatible materials to avoid corrosion and ensure proper spacing and slope for effective drainage. Experienced contractors will also factor in the unique pitch and runoff rate of metal roofs.
-
What is the typical lifespan of gutters on metal roofs?
The lifespan depends on the material used and maintenance practices:
- Aluminum gutters: 20–30 years
- Galvanized steel gutters: 20+ years with proper care
- Copper gutters: 50+ years and develop a natural patina
Regular cleaning and inspections can extend the life of any gutter system, especially when paired with a durable metal roof.
